Morocco has been installed as hosts for the 2018 African Nations Championship (CHAN).

The decision to unanimously give Morocco the hosting rights for the tournament ahead of Equatorial Guinea was confirmed earlier on Sunday by the Confederation of African Football (Caf).

The decision was taken at an emergency CAF executive committee meeting in Lagos, Nigeria.

The CHAN tournament is for locally-based players and the next edition is scheduled to take place in January and February 2018.

Third candidates, Ethiopia, were not considered by the football body after they didn’t provide a letter of guarantee from the country’s government.

With Morocco confirmed as CHAN 2018 hosts, Egypt will take their place. They had earlier defeated their North African rivals during the qualifiers.
